#4e5ca7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4e5ca7 is composed of 30.6% red, 36.1%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 44.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 230.6 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 48%. #4e5ca7 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cb8ff with #00004f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#4e5ca7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030407 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e5ca7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747681 is the less saturated color, while #0328f2 is the most saturated one.
